Sunday saw the first of this seasons campo fires, and at one stage it put in doubt Sunday´s walk, as it was in the barranco de Rio Verde the valley that we had intended to walk in. Fortunately because of our planned late start, it was an afternoon walk, the Bomberos and the helicopters had succeeded in bringing the fire under control, and they were just damping down by the time we arrived at the other side of the valley. This weeks walk was split, with a very easy section to start with along the top of the gorge for the ones who wanted a short walk, and a trip up the steep sided gorge of the Rio Durcal for the ones who wanted to go further. The gorge walk has lost some of its beauty over the years as successive storms have somehow altered the river flow. When we first discovered it you walked through a series of waterfalls, now there is no water in the river at all, but it is still a spectacular gorge to walk in.
